MySQL导出用户权限脚本

来源:互联网 发布:男皮带 淘宝 知乎 编辑:程序博客网 时间:2024/05/18 00:46
#!/bin/bash#Function export user privilegesexpgrants(){  mysql -B -N $@ -e "SELECT CONCAT('SHOW GRANTS FOR ''',user, '''@''', host, ''';') AS query FROM mysql.user" | \  mysql $@ | \  sed 's/\(GRANT .*\)/\1;/;s/^\(Grants for .*\)/-- \1 /;/--/{x;p;x;}'}expgrants > ./grants.sql


原创粉丝点击